Required Skills:

  • Bachelor's degree in information systems, Engineering, Computer Science, or related field from an accredited university. 
  • Intermediate experience in a Hadoop production environment. 
  • Must have intermediate experience and expert knowledge with at least 4 of the following: 
  • Hands on experience with Hadoop administration in Linux and virtual environments. 
  • Well versed in installing & managing distributions of Hadoop (Cloudera). 
  • Expert knowledge and hands-on experience in Hadoop ecosystem components; including HDFS, Yarn, Hive, LLAP, Druid, Impala, Spark, Kafka, HBase, Cloudera Work Bench, etc. 
  • Thorough knowledge of Hadoop overall architecture. 
  • Experience using and troubleshooting Open-Source technologies including configuration management and deployment. 
  • Data Lake and Data Warehousing design and development. 
  • Experience reviewing existing DB and Hadoop infrastructure and determine areas of improvement. 
  • Implementing software lifecycle methodology to ensure supported release and roadmap adherence. 
  • Configuring high availability of name-nodes. 
  • Scheduling and taking backups for Hadoop ecosystem. 
  • Data movement in and out of Hadoop clusters.
